SPECIFICATIONS:
Audio Power Source: Supplied by master station
Speaker: 20 ohms, 4W, 2" diameter, water proof and puncture resistant, 2.4 oz. magnet
Call Button: SPST call button, momentary activation. Limited stop button.
Call Annunciation: Pressing the call button at sub activates and latches call at NEM/NDR/NDRM master. The master
station's LED will be lit and a ringing tone will be heard until the call is answered.
Communication: Hands free at sub. Master is push-to-talk or VOX with handset.
CCTV Camera Output: 75 Ohm, 1Vp-p, NTSC, DC-coupled
Iris Control: Auto
Minimum Illumination: 1.0 lux
Camera image sensor: 1/3" CCD
Focal Length: 4.3mm Cone Pinhole Lens (78°)
Effective Pixels: 510(H) x 492(V) NTSC
Camera Power Source: 12V DC, 100mA (via included power supply)
MTBF: (Mean Time Before Failure) 80,000 Hours
Faceplate: 12 gauge stainless steel
Mounting: Flush mount into a 2-gang box (minimum 2-½” depth) or surface mount into SBX-2G (sold separately)
Tamper proof screws included (6x32 for use with flush 2-gang box) with T-10 TORX bit
When using SBX-2G, use the hardware included with that unit.
Terminations: Color-coded prewired pigtails
Operating Temperature: 14
F ~ 140°F (-10°C ~ 60°C)
Audio Wiring: 2 conductors homerun; or 1 common plus 1 individual per sub, looped through each sub.
Shielded cable is recommended.
Use Aiphone #822202 or #821802 for homerun wiring, #822206 for up to 5 stations
on each run, or #822210 for up to 9 stations on each run.
Audio Wiring Distance: 420' with 22AWG; 1,000' with 18AWG
Video Wiring: Independent BNC connection from substation pigtail to destination video device
Dimensions (HxWxD): NE-SSV alone: 4-11/16" x 4-11/16" x 2"
With SBX-2G: 4-3/4" x 4-7/8" x 3-5/8" (Top) 2-3/8" (Bottom)

NOTE: If using fiber optic interface, the video input on
the IFS VIC-5211 is not compatible with the NE-SSV
camera. The VIC-5211 can be used for audio only,
with a separate fiber module required for video.
